123visa   

Tourist Visa, Travel, Holidays ...

Senegal > Afghanistan


Tourist Visa, Travel, Holidays ... Senegal South Africa
Tourist Visa, Travel, Holidays ... Senegal Albania
Tourist Visa, Travel, Holidays ... Senegal Algeria
Tourist Visa, Travel, Holidays ... Senegal Germany
Tourist Visa, Travel, Holidays ... Senegal Andorra






123visa